Design and Build Quality

The Elite Active 75t features a compact, ergonomic design that fits securely in the ear. Its sweat and water resistance rating of IP57 makes it suitable for intense workouts and outdoor activities. The sturdy build ensures durability, even after months of rigorous use.

Audio Performance

In 2026, the earbuds still deliver rich, balanced sound with deep bass and clear highs. The customizable equalizer via the Jabra app allows users to tailor their listening experience. Active noise cancellation is effective, though some users note it’s less advanced than newer models introduced in recent years.

Battery Life and Charging

The 75t offers up to 7.5 hours of playback on a single charge, with an additional 20 hours provided by the charging case. Fast charging provides approximately 1 hour of use from just 15 minutes of charging, which remains a significant advantage for busy users.

Comfort and Fit

The earbuds come with multiple ear tip sizes, ensuring a snug fit for most users. The lightweight design minimizes ear fatigue during extended workouts. Many users report that the earbuds stay secure even during high-intensity exercises.

Connectivity and Features

Equipped with Bluetooth 5.2, the Elite Active 75t offers quick pairing and a stable connection. Features like automatic ear detection, customizable controls, and a dedicated fitness mode enhance the workout experience. However, some newer models now include advanced sensors and health tracking, which the 75t lacks.
